The 1998 Avalon would receive new head and tail lamps, a new front grille and trunk lid, new pre-tensioner seatbelts and new side-impact airbags. For the 1999 Avalon, Toyota added daytime running lights and powered mirrors to the Avalon. A roomier and more powerful car was built for the 2000 Avalon, boasting new interior and exterior styling, updated safety features, improved engine power and a smoother drive. The only update for 2001 was the addition of an emergency trunk release handle.
No major updates were in store for 2002. But in 2003, a new grille was added alongside updated tail lamps, bumpers and new dual-stage airbags and child safety seat anchor points. No changes were made for 2004, with a completely redesigned model being issued in 2005. Trim level updates marked the only changes for 2006-2007. Updated front fascias, new headlamps, a new remote entry system and a more efficient braking system were the only changes for 2008. For 2009, the Avalon got stability control and active whiplash reducing features added as standard equipment. Rear express up/down windows were the big update for 2010.
A new front and rear style, a brand new dashboard and tweaks to standard features were the only updates for 2011. There were not any updates for 2012, with Toyota releasing a completely redesigned Avalon for 2013. It would enter 2014 relatively unchanged.
